Despite saying last week that it would be hard for the Reds to keep him in town, infielder Brandon Phillips says his first choice would be a contract extension from the club. Phillips has a $12 million option for 2012 in his contract. "I told the Reds and the whole world this is where I want to be," Phillips said. "If it doesn't happen, I'm going to be very, very disappointed. I feel like I've made this a second home. I bought a house here. This is where I want to be, man. The fans just took me in. "I feel like I need to stay here and give back. Hopefully, it happens. If it doesn't happen this year, I feel in my head and my heart, it's not going to happen."
